Honda sweeps North American Car and Truck of the Year Awards

At the opening press conference of the North American International Auto Show, Honda Motor Company swept the North American Car and Truck Of The Year Awards with the Civic and Ridgeline.  Chris and I were on the scene, capturing John Mendel, Honda of America's Senior Vice President as he accepted the award (photo). This marks the first time that one manufacturer has captured the award in both categories in the same year. It is also Honda's first victory in either category.

The 12th annual NACOTY and NATOTY awards were decided by 49 journalists from the United States and Canada who considered over 50 vehicles that were eligible this year. Honda beat out two other vehicles per category -- the Ford Fusion and the Pontiac Solstice in the car category, and the Nissan Xterra and Ford Explorer in the truck category.
